Yahoo Chief Creative Officer Salaries in Los Angeles

The average Yahoo Chief Creative Officer in Los Angeles earns an estimated $206,218 annually. Yahoo's Chief Creative Officer compensation is $119,406 less than the US average for a Chief Creative Officer.

In Los Angeles, The Design Department at Yahoo earns $5,525 more on average than the HR Department.

Chief Creative Officer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female Chief Creative Officer at companies similar size to Yahoo reported making $242,693, while the average male Chief Creative Officer at similar sized companies reported making $249,071.

Chief Creative Officer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Asian or Pacific Islander Chief Creative Officer at companies similar size to Yahoo reported making $233,750, while the average Hispanic or Latino Chief Creative Officer at similar sized companies reported making $215,000.

How Chief Creative Officers at Yahoo Rate Their Compensation

The majority of Chief Creative Officers at Yahoo believe they're compensated fairly. 86% of Chief Creative Officers at Yahoo say they receive annual bonuses, and the vast majority (79%) are satisfied with their benefits. See more compensation ratings at Yahoo
